.body {
	background-image: url(..//imaggem_imagens/bg.jpg);
	background-repeat: repeat;
}


.bg {
	background-image: url(..//imaggem_imagens/bg.jpg);
	background-repeat: repeat;
}

a:link 
  {
  	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#333333;
	
	font-weight: normal;
	font-style: normal;
	font-variant: normal;
	}
a:visited 
  {
  	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#CC3333;
	font-weight: normal;
	font-style: normal;
	font-variant: normal;
	}
a:hover 
  {
  	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#CC3333;
	font-weight: normal;
	font-style: normal;
	font-variant: normal;
	}
  a:active 
  {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#CC3333;
	font-weight: normal;
	font-style: normal;
	font-variant: normal;

	}



.principal {
	border: 4px double #CCCCCC;
	width: 780px;

}
.starbglf {
	background-image: url(..//imaggem_imagens/starbg_lf.jpg);
	background-repeat: no-repeat;
	background-position: center bottom;
	height: 357px;
	background-color: #FFFFFF;
	padding: 25px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#CC3333;



}
.starbgrg {
	background-image: url(..//imaggem_imagens/starbg_rg.jpg);
	background-repeat: no-repeat;
	height: 357px;
	background-color: #FFFFFF;
	background-position: center bottom;
	padding-right: 25px;
	padding-bottom: 25px;
	padding-left: 25px;




}
.contatobg {
	background-image: url(..//imaggem_imagens/contato_bg.gif);
	background-repeat: no-repeat;
	height: 77px;
}

.videosbg {
	background-image: url(..//imaggem_imagens/videos_bg.gif);
	background-repeat: no-repeat;
	height: 77px;
}
.servicosbg {
	background-image: url(..//imaggem_imagens/servicos_bg.gif);
	background-repeat: no-repeat;
	height: 77px;
}

.producoesbg {
	background-image: url(..//imaggem_imagens/producoes_bg.gif);
	background-repeat: no-repeat;
	height: 77px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	padding: 56px 0px 0px 170px;
	background-color: #FFFFFF;



}
.empresabg {
	background-image: url(..//imaggem_imagens/empresa_bg.gif);
	background-repeat: no-repeat;
	height: 77px;
}


.testimonialsbg {
	background-image: url(..//imaggem_imagens/testimonials_bg.gif);
	background-repeat: no-repeat;
	height: 77px;
	background-color: #FFFFFF;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#CC3333;
	font-weight: bold;
	padding-top: 50px;
	padding-left: 570px;


}
.clientesbg {
	background-image: url(..//imaggem_imagens/clientes_bg.gif);
	background-repeat: no-repeat;
	height: 77px;
}
.eventossociaisbg {
	background-image: url(..//imaggem_imagens/eventos_sociais_bg.gif);
	background-repeat: no-repeat;
	height: 77px;
}
.comerciaisbg {
	background-image: url(..//imaggem_imagens/comerciais_bg.gif);
	background-repeat: no-repeat;
	height: 77px;
}

.treiinstbg {
	background-image: url(..//imaggem_imagens/treinamentos_institucionais_bg.gif);
	background-repeat: no-repeat;
	height: 77px;
}


.documentariosbg {
	background-image: url(..//imaggem_imagens/documentarios_bg.gif);
	background-repeat: no-repeat;
	height: 77px;
}



.textred {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#CC3333;
	font-size: 12px;
	font-weight: normal;
	font-style: normal;
	font-variant: normal;
	text-align: justify;
	width: 300px;
	background-image: url(..//imaggem_imagens/bg_01.jpg);
	background-repeat: no-repeat;
	background-position: 320px 10px;

}
.textrednobg {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#CC3333;
	font-size: 12px;
	font-weight: normal;
	font-style: normal;
	font-variant: normal;
	text-align: justify;
	
}

.textredservicos {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#CC3333;
	font-size: 12px;
	font-weight: normal;
	font-style: normal;
	font-variant: normal;
	text-align: justify;
	width: 300px;
	background-image: url(..//imaggem_imagens/bg_08.jpg);
	background-repeat: no-repeat;
	background-position: 320px 10px;
	height: 350px;


}

.textredeventossociais {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#CC3333;
	font-size: 12px;
	font-weight: normal;
	font-style: normal;
	font-variant: normal;
	text-align: right;
	width: 680px;
	background-image: url(..//imaggem_imagens/bg_001.jpg);
	background-repeat: no-repeat;
	padding-left: 350px;
	height: 480px;
	background-position: 0px 0px;


}

.textredcomerciais {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#CC3333;
	font-size: 12px;
	font-weight: normal;
	font-style: normal;
	font-variant: normal;
	text-align: right;
	width: 680px;
	background-image: url(..//imaggem_imagens/bg_05.jpg);
	background-repeat: no-repeat;
	padding-left: 350px;
	height: 440px;

}

.textredtreina {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#CC3333;
	font-size: 12px;
	font-weight: normal;
	font-style: normal;
	font-variant: normal;
	text-align: right;
	width: 680px;
	background-image: url(..//imaggem_imagens/bg_06.jpg);
	background-repeat: no-repeat;
	padding-left: 350px;
	height: 440px;

}

.textredproducoes {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#CC3333;
	font-size: 12px;
	font-weight: normal;
	font-style: normal;
	font-variant: normal;
	text-align: right;
	width: 680px;
	background-image: url(..//imaggem_imagens/bg_02.jpg);
	background-repeat: no-repeat;
	padding-left: 350px;
	height: 480px;

}

.textreddocumentarios {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#CC3333;
	font-size: 12px;
	font-weight: normal;
	font-style: normal;
	font-variant: normal;
	text-align: right;
	width: 680px;
	background-image: url(..//imaggem_imagens/bg_07.jpg);
	background-repeat: no-repeat;
	padding-left: 365px;
	height: 480px;

}


.textoempresa {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#666666;
	width: 300px;
	font-style: normal;
	font-weight: normal;
	font-variant: normal;

}
.destaque {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#666666;
	font-size: 14px;
	font-weight: bold;
}
.enterpe {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#333333;
	background-image: url(..//imaggem_imagens/bg_enter.gif);
	background-repeat: no-repeat;
	height: 143px;
	margin: 0px;
	padding-left: 10px;
	padding-top: 15px;
	font-style: italic;


}
.h1 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1px;
	color: #CC6666;
}

.campo_alerta
{
font-family: Tahoma, Verdana, Arial;
font-size: 11px;
border: 1px solid black;
background-color: #ffff99;
}
.texto_pagina
{
font-family: Tahoma, Verdana, Arial;
font-size: 11px;
color: dimgray;
}

.tabela_formulario
{
width: 200;
background-color: white;
}

.titulo_campos
{
font-family: Tahoma, Verdana, Arial;
font-size: 11px;
color: dimgray;
background-color: whitesmoke;
}

.campos_formulario
{
font-family: Tahoma, Verdana, Arial;
font-size: 11px;
color: dimgray;
background-color: gainsboro;
border: 1px inset;
}

.botao_enviar
{
font-family: Tahoma, Verdana, Arial;
font-size: 11px;
color: white;
background-color: gray;
}
.texto_pagina
{
font-family: Tahoma, Verdana, Arial;
font-size: 11px;
color: dimgray;
}

.tabela_registros
{
width: 100%;
background-color: white;
}

.titulos_registros
{
font-family: Tahoma, Verdana, Arial;
font-size: 11px;
color: white;
background-color: gray;
}

.exibe_registros
{
font-family: Tahoma, Verdana, Arial;
font-size: 11px;
width: 100%;
color: dimgray;
background-color: whitesmoke;
}

.tabela_paginacao
{
font-family: Tahoma, Verdana, Arial;
font-size: 11px;
width: 100%;
color: gray;
border-top: 1px solid gainsboro;
background-color: gainsboro;
}

.links_paginacao
{
color: dimgray;
text-decoration: none;
}

.links_paginacao:hover
{
color: gray;
text-decoration: underline;
}
